Go for AMDGPU if you have everything in place (LLVM latest version, GCN 1.0 requires kernel 4.9 activated beforehand, GCN 1.1 and up require kernel 4.8 activated beforehand).

You can check what you're on by running glxinfo, that will tell you in detail what is used for what rendering technology.
